Пример #1
0
        public override void OnPageLoad(object sender, EventArgs e)
        {
            model                       = new AdvertisersQueryVM();
            model.ChannelID             = "1";
            QuerySection.DataContext    = model;
            btnStackPanel.DataContext   = model;
            filter                      = new AdvertiserQueryFilter();
            filter.CompanyCode          = Newegg.Oversea.Silverlight.ControlPanel.Core.CPApplication.Current.CompanyCode;
            facade                      = new AdvertiserFacade(this);
            cbShowComment.SelectedIndex = 0;
            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n status = QueryResultGrid.Columns[4] as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n;
            status.Binding.ConverterParameter = typeof(ADStatus);

            base.OnPageLoad(sender, e);
        }
Пример #2
0
        void UCVendorQuery_Loaded(object sender, RoutedEventArgs e)
        {
            this.Loaded -= UCVendorQuery_Loaded;

            validateList = new List <ValidationEntity>();
            validateList.Add(new ValidationEntity(ValidationEnum.IsInteger, this.txtVendorSysNo.Text, "供应商编号必须为整数"));

            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n colStatus = this.QueryResultGrid.Columns[2] as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n;
            colStatus.Binding.ConverterParameter = typeof(ValidStatus);
            BindComboBoxData();
            serviceFacade    = new VendorFacade(CPApplication.Current.CurrentPage);
            queryVM          = new VendorQueryVM();
            queryFilter      = new VendorQueryFilter();
            this.DataContext = queryVM;
        }
Пример #3
0
 public override void OnPageLoad(object sender, EventArgs e)
 {
     queryRequest            = new CSQueryFilter();
     vm                      = new CSSetVM();
     this.DataContext        = vm;
     facade                  = new CSFacade(this);
     queryRequest.PagingInfo = new ECCentral.QueryFilter.Common.PagingInfo()
     {
         PageSize  = CSGrid.PageSize,
         PageIndex = 0,
         SortBy    = string.Empty
     };
     vm.RoleList = EnumConverter.GetKeyValuePairs <CSRole>(EnumConverter.EnumAppendItemType.All);
     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n role = this.CSGrid.Columns[1] as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n;
     role.Binding.ConverterParameter = typeof(CSRole);
     base.OnPageLoad(sender, e);
     CheckRights();
 }
Пример #4
0
        public override void OnPageLoad(object sender, EventArgs e)
        {
            filter                    = new ReviewScoreItemQueryFilter();
            facade                    = new ReviewScoreItemFacade(this);
            model                     = new ReviewScoreItemQueryVM();
            filter.CompanyCode        = Newegg.Oversea.Silverlight.ControlPanel.Core.CPApplication.Current.CompanyCode;
            model.ChannelID           = "1";
            QuerySection.DataContext  = model;
            btnStackPanel.DataContext = model;

            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n status = QueryResultGrid.Columns[4] as Newegg.Oversea.Silverlight.Controls.Data.DataGridTextColumn;
            status.Binding.ConverterParameter = typeof(ECCentral.BizEntity.MKT.ADStatus);

            cbStatus.ItemsSource = EnumConverter.GetKeyValuePairs <ECCentral.BizEntity.MKT.ADStatus>(EnumConverter.EnumAppendItemType.All);
            //new CommonDataFacade(CPApplication.Current.CurrentPage).GetWebChannelList(false, (s, args) =>
            //{
            //    this.lstChannel.ItemsSource = args.Result;
            //    //this.lstChannel.SelectedIndex = 0;
            //});

            base.OnPageLoad(sender, e);
        }